Result Details
Boosted Decision Trees for Behaviour Mining of Concurrent Programs
        ŠIMKOVÁ, H.; LETKO, Z.; KŘENA, B.; VOJNAR, T.; DUDKA, V.; AVROS, R.; UR, S.; VOLKOVICH, Z. Boosted Decision Trees for Behaviour Mining of Concurrent Programs. Proceedings of MEMICS'14. Brno: NOVPRESS s.r.o., 2014. p. 15-27.  ISBN: 978-80-214-5022-6.
    
                Type
            
        
                conference paper
            
        
                Language
            
        
                English
            
        
            Authors
            
        
                Šimková Hana, Mgr. Bc., Ph.D., DITS (FIT)
                
Letko Zdeněk, Ing., Ph.D., DITS (FIT)
Křena Bohuslav, Ing., Ph.D., DITS (FIT)
Vojnar Tomáš, prof. Ing., Ph.D., DITS (FIT)
Dudka Vendula, Ing., FIT (FIT)
Avros Renata
Ur Shmuel
Volkovich Zeev
        Letko Zdeněk, Ing., Ph.D., DITS (FIT)
Křena Bohuslav, Ing., Ph.D., DITS (FIT)
Vojnar Tomáš, prof. Ing., Ph.D., DITS (FIT)
Dudka Vendula, Ing., FIT (FIT)
Avros Renata
Ur Shmuel
Volkovich Zeev
                    Abstract
            
        Testing of concurrent programs is difficult since the scheduling non-determinism requires one to test a huge number of different thread interleavings. Moreover, a simple repetition of test executions will typically examine similar interleavings only. One popular way how to deal with this
problem is to use the noise injection approach, which is, however, parameterized with many parameters whose suitable values are difficult to find. In this paper,
we propose a novel application of classification-based data mining for this purpose. Our approach can identify which test and noise parameters are the most influential for a given program and a given testing goal and which values (or
ranges of values) of these parameters are suitable for meeting this goal. We present experiments that show that our approach can indeed fully automatically
improve noise-based testing of particular programs with a~particular testing goal. At the same time, we use it to obtain new general insights into noise-based testing as well.
            
                Keywords
            
        Testing, noise injection, classification, AdaBoost, multi-threaded programs
                Published
            
            
                    2014
                    
                
            
                    Pages
                
            
                        15–27
                
            
                        Proceedings
                
            
                    Proceedings of MEMICS'14
                
            
                    Conference
                
            
                    MEMICS'14 -- 9th Doctoral Workshop on Mathematical and Engineering Methods in Computer Science
                
            
                    ISBN
                
            
                    978-80-214-5022-6
                
            
                    Publisher
                
            
                    NOVPRESS s.r.o.
                
            
                    Place
                
            
                    Brno
                
            
                    BibTeX
                
            @inproceedings{BUT111631,
  author="Hana {Šimková} and Zdeněk {Letko} and Bohuslav {Křena} and Tomáš {Vojnar} and Vendula {Dudka} and Renata {Avros} and Shmuel {Ur} and Zeev {Volkovich}",
  title="Boosted Decision Trees for Behaviour Mining of Concurrent Programs",
  booktitle="Proceedings of MEMICS'14",
  year="2014",
  pages="15--27",
  publisher="NOVPRESS s.r.o.",
  address="Brno",
  isbn="978-80-214-5022-6"
}
                
                Projects
            
        
        
            
        
    
    
        Intelligent Testing and Analysis of Concurrent Software, MŠMT, KONTAKT II (2011-2017), LH13265, start: 2013-04-01, end: 2015-03-31, completed
                
Spolehlivost a bezpečnost v IT, BUT, Vnitřní projekty VUT, FIT-S-14-2486, start: 2014-01-01, end: 2016-12-31, completed
Support of Interdisciplinary Excellence Research Teams Establishment at BUT, EU, OP VK - Oblast podpory 2.3 - Lidské zdroje ve VaV, EE2.3.30.0005, start: 2012-07-01, end: 2015-06-30, completed
Verifikace a optimalizace počítačových systémů, BUT, Vnitřní projekty VUT, FIT-S-12-1, start: 2012-01-01, end: 2014-12-31, completed
        Spolehlivost a bezpečnost v IT, BUT, Vnitřní projekty VUT, FIT-S-14-2486, start: 2014-01-01, end: 2016-12-31, completed
Support of Interdisciplinary Excellence Research Teams Establishment at BUT, EU, OP VK - Oblast podpory 2.3 - Lidské zdroje ve VaV, EE2.3.30.0005, start: 2012-07-01, end: 2015-06-30, completed
Verifikace a optimalizace počítačových systémů, BUT, Vnitřní projekty VUT, FIT-S-12-1, start: 2012-01-01, end: 2014-12-31, completed
                Research groups
            
        
                Departments